About the Role This position is responsible for coordinating activities and supporting the delivery of initiatives in Workplace Health and Safety (WHS).
The role ensures that WHS initiatives, audit actions, documentation, data and key performance indicators are effectively implemented and monitored, and coordinates the promotion and education of WHS.
The role acts as the administrative support to the WHS committee and supports groups such as the Contact Officers, First Aid Officers and WHS Representatives, and will also support project work across the broader Organisational Development team, as required.
